Governor Wolf recently announced a relief package for Pennsylvania small businesses. The COVID-19 Relief Pennsylvania Statewide Small Business Assistance program will provide grants ranging between $5,000 and $50,000 to small businesses that have been economically impacted by COVID-19. A business MUST meet the following criteria to be eligible:

  • Be physically located, certified to do business, AND generate at least 51% of their revenues in Pennsylvania;
  • Have annual revenue of $1 million or less prior to COVID-19; AND
  • Have 25 or fewer full-time equivalent employees prior to February 15, 2020.

This program prioritizes small businesses and at least 50% of the grants will be going to those described as historically disadvantaged businesses. Unfortunately, it is not available to nonprofits, churches or other religious organizations.

Detailed information about this program, including how and what is needed to apply, can be found here. Please note the application window will begin Tuesday, June 30. This is NOT a first-come first-serve program and the application window will remain open for 10 days. Additional rounds of funding may become available.
